    Had an alright experience. They were playing Bad Bunny's DTMF on repeat (which we loved because that entire album is fire), but the food and drinks leave a lot to be desired. We ordered the Tripleta sandwich which was soooo dry. Like I was worried it would get caught in my esophagus. Then we ordered the Cafe Con Ron drinks and WHEW. It was strong. I couldn't taste any coffee at all. If you told me that was just rum in a cup I would've believed you. Overall, the service was nice, and the ambience is super cool, but this isn't what I would recommend if you're looking for good food and drinks.

    Was in PR for the Bad Bunny concert so of course we had to stop in his bar. We came for the cafe con Ron drinks but unfortunately, due to the water shortage, those weren't available. The staff made up for the loss with friendly service and delicious drinks. Our neighbors had some food and kept saying how great everything was. Our cocktails were executed perfectly and before we left we had the obligatory pitorro (hey that's what Benito would have wanted). I loved the decor and total PR vibe. The line was around the block to get in, but they did an amazing job keeping the space comfortable to enjoy your experience. I'll definitely be back to try more of the menu and get my cafe con Ron!

    We came to Puerto Rico for the Bad Bunny concert and so of course we had to stop in at Café con Ron. We got lucky as there was only a little line when we arrived. As time passed that line got very long lol. But I appreciate that once we got inside it did not feel packed or overcrowded. My friend and I were seated at the bar. We could not order the signature drink as this section of old son Juan does not have running water and they can't clean the mixers out to make the drink. They did have other alternatives for us though. I tried the favorito de mi ex. The drink was absolutely delicious. It was fresh not overpower sweet. We enjoyed talking to the bartender people next to us and listening to great music. We couldn't leave without each having a shot of Pitorro de Coco. This actually ended up being the best one I had while on the island and I had quite a few lol. Definitely a part of the experience if you're coming for the Bad Bunny concert, you will enjoy yourself. But get there early so you don't have to wait in line.
